John TROWBRIDGE was born in 1743 in Chatham, Middlesex, Connecticut, United States, the child of John Trowbridge And Hannah Crocker. John TROWBRIDGE had children including Sarah Hartshorn. John TROWBRIDGE passed away in 1831 in Young, Texas, United States.
